How a run actually starts: the rider sits on a packed platform of snow with the board laid across in front, both knees up, one hand pulling the ankle strap of the front binding through its ratchet and the other steadying the board. The pack has been taken off and dropped behind.
Bounding size 1.55 x 1.10 x 0.91 m (X x Y x Z), metre units, +Y up, +Z forward, resting on y=0.
Board, bindings and body are one static assembly; no named pivot nodes.
Static geometry; no rig, collision or navigation data.
